We can import more than one image from a file using the glob module. WebRescale operation resizes an image by a given scaling factor. The scaling factor can either be a single floating point value, or multiple values - one along each axis. Resize serves the same purpose, but allows to specify an output image shape instead of a scaling factor.

WebThe key idea in image sub-sampling is to throw away every other row and column to create a half-size image. When the sampling rate gets too low, we are not able to capture the details in the image anymore. Instead, we should have a minimum signal/image rate, called the Nyquist rate.
